The temperature ranged from 8.3°C around 12:00 to 17.3°C around 00:00. Rain was recorded across 10 hours, from around 00:00 to 10:00 (17.2mm total).

Source
ERA5 reanalysis, accessed via the Copernicus Climate Change Service (C3S) Climate Data Store
Data type
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ast
